If you’re driving through Tucson’s Palo Verde neighborhood and see dozens of people staring up at a tree, you might have stumbled upon an owl party. Each evening, these people gather to see what the resident Great Horned Owl family is doing, and in the process, get to know their neighbors and create a stronger community.
